Output 19c66e23272c32e4bc0d2babfb80d0a011a68aad5f0cb01a62f9d0a08d79feca:0

value
231435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4f61370d0a88fc5b65f6bd2f6f94f427f367b2 OP_EQUAL
address
3Cw28YJ1p5AgpRVAhHgv7pVVoCB26FH29r
transaction
19c66e23272c32e4bc0d2babfb80d0a011a68aad5f0cb01a62f9d0a08d79feca
spent
true